AGL modifies disclosure policy on lead-glass-filled rubies

The American Gemological Laboratories (AGL) has modified its disclosure policy regarding lead-glass-filled rubies.

Effective immediately, the AGL will identify these gems as composite rubies, listing their standard enhancement as heat and their additional enhancement as lead-glass.

Under comments, the AGL will state: "This ruby has been heavily treated using a high refractive index lead-glass to fill fractures and cavities, vastly improving the apparent clarity and potentially adding weight. The glass may be damaged by a variety of solvents. Stability: Good to fair."
